> 4.7% failure of the test OtelTracerConfiguratorTest.
> {code:java}
> org.apache.solr.opentelemetry.OtelTracerConfiguratorTest > classMethod FAILED
> com.carrotsearch.randomizedtesting.ThreadLeakError: 1 thread leaked from
> SUITE scope at org.apache.solr.opentelemetry.OtelTracerConfiguratorTest:
> 1) Thread[id=64, name=BatchSpanProcessor_WorkerThread-1,
> state=TIMED_WAITING, group=TGRP-OtelTracerConfiguratorTest]
> at [email protected]/jdk.internal.misc.Unsafe.park(Native Method)
> at
> [email protected]/java.util.concurrent.locks.LockSupport.parkNanos(LockSupport.java:234)
> at
> [email protected]/java.util.concurrent.locks.AbstractQueuedSynchronizer$ConditionObject.awaitNanos(AbstractQueuedSynchronizer.java:2123)
> at
> [email protected]/java.util.concurrent.ArrayBlockingQueue.poll(ArrayBlockingQueue.java:432)
> at
> app//io.opentelemetry.sdk.trace.export.BatchSpanProcessor$Worker.run(BatchSpanProcessor.java:252)
> at [email protected]/java.lang.Thread.run(Thread.java:829)
> at __randomizedtesting.SeedInfo.seed([CCCE79C05B3FB703]:0) {code}
> The tracer uses a BatchSpanProcessor by default, which has its own thread. It
> will eventually exit, but the test fails
